Creating Awareness of our An expanding network Service Offering Awareness campaigns in the communities that the Smile Foundation services are essential and help to overcome stigmas and discrimination against young people who have facialdeformities. The aim of the Smile Foundation is to provide these youngsterswith access to (often simple) medical procedures and give them a chance to lead a normal, happy life. At this stage the Smile Foundation is based in seven Academic Hospitals in five provinces within South Africa. Theyhave developed and established a model that is in the process of being rolled-out into all Academic hospitals in the country.
